Therapeutic Approaches for Online Care
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) helps clients notice difficult thoughts and feelings without getting stuck in them, then identify personal values to guide meaningful actions. It can be useful for anxiety, depression, and coping with life changes.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) focuses on identifying unhelpful thinking and behavior patterns and replacing them with practical skills to reduce symptoms and improve day-to-day functioning - often used for anxiety, depression, and stress-related concerns. Client-Centered Therapy emphasizes empathy, active listening, and building a collaborative relationship so clients feel understood and supported while exploring emotions and setting goals.
